Stock events for Procore Technologies, Inc. (PCOR)
Procore Technologies' stock price experienced fluctuations in the past six months. In November 2025, shares fell to a 52-week low due to challenging economic conditions, but rallied to a 52-week high in late March 2026 after a better-than-expected Q4 2025 earnings report. Despite Q1 2026 revenue beating estimates, adjusted EPS missed expectations, leading to a stock price drop. As of May 7, 2026, Procore's stock price was $53.51, representing a decrease of 26.8% year-to-date. The appointment of an AI expert to Procore's Board of Directors in early May 2026 drew attention to potential AI integration.

Overview of Procore Technologies, Inc.’s business
Procore Technologies, Inc. is a global provider of cloud-based construction management software, connecting stakeholders in the construction industry. The company operates in the Technology Services sector, specifically in Application Software and Packaged Software industries, and is recognized within the Construction Technology and Real Estate Technology verticals. Procore generates revenue through subscriptions for its cloud-based SaaS construction management platform, offering solutions for preconstruction, project execution, workforce management, financial management, and construction intelligence.
PCOR’s Geographic footprint
Procore Technologies is headquartered in Carpinteria, California, and has a significant global presence. The company has expanded its operations across North America, with offices throughout the US and Canada. Internationally, Procore has established hubs in Europe, the Middle East, Asia, and North Africa (EMEA/MENA), including offices in London, Dublin, Paris, Dubai, and Cairo. In the Asia-Pacific (APAC) region, Procore has offices in Sydney, Australia, and India. Procore's products are used by customers in over 160 countries.

Ownership
Procore Technologies' ownership is primarily dominated by institutional investors, who hold approximately 85.24% of the shares. Major institutional owners include ICONIQ Capital, LLC, Vanguard Group Inc, and Morgan Stanley. Individual and insider ownership accounts for approximately 10.29% of the shares, including key shareholders such as ICONIQ Strategic Partners III LP, Divesh Makan, and Craig 'Tooey' Courtemanche Jr.
